Watercolor Painting Art Lesson - Using plastic wrap to get a unique abstract look
In this YouTube exclusive art class, Miss Linda shows you one of her favorite techniques to get a gorgeous abstract watercolor painting. Using liquid watercolor paints and plastic cling wrap, this art lesson is suitable for all ages and levels of artistic experience. 0:00-0:27 Introduction and background 0:28-7:39 Watercolor lesson 7:40-8:03 Goodbye and social media info Materials: Liquid watercolor paints (including metallic paints if you can) White watercolor paper Squeeze bottles Plastic cling wrap Paper towels or a dry art towel Optional materials: Pan watercolor paints A paintbrush Two cups filled with water Matting A frame Music by Charles Judge https://www.artwithmisslinda.com
